What jobs can I get? How much can I get paid?
Degrees and certificates in the Accounting program may lead to the following jobs or careers:
Bookkeeping/ Accounting/Auditing Clerk
$12.98
Entry Hourly Wage
Accountant/Auditor[1]
$24.68
Entry Hourly Wage
Tax Examiner/Collector and Revenue Agent[1]
$24.28
Entry Hourly Wage
1 This job may require a bachelor's degree or higher. Please
review current job openings and contact your advisor to review your options.
All data gathered for Dallas/Fort Worth. Source: Dallas College Labor Market Intelligence
Why is This a Good Career Bet?
CareerOneStop, sponsored by the U.S. Department of Labor, projects job growth increase of 24% for accountants and auditors, 23% for financial examiners, 19% for financial analysts and 18% for tax preparers.
